  • It is very helpful to have between $2500 and $4000 or more to assist with buying or renting a place to live, car rental (if not driving to Alaska), gasoline, and grocery shopping.
  • One (1) bedroom will range from $755 and up. Two (2) bedroom will range from $950 and up. Three (3) bedroom will range from $1400 and up. All price ranges will vary by location, utilities, pet(s) allowance, etc.
